Judulnya sedikit membingungkan dan tidak asosiatif dengan maksud yang sebenarnya, tapi intinya begini, kasusnya adalah bagaimana menambahkan (increment) 1 hari dari suatu tanggal tertentu, misalnya sekarang adalah tanggal 17 Agustus 2017, maka output yang dihasilkan adalah tanggal 18 Agustus 2017. Mungkin ada yang terbersit, apa susahnya tinggal tambah satu operator plus satu (+1). Hmmmm tidak, tidak demikian perlakuannya, mungkin cara seperti itu bisa saja dilakukan namun bagaimana jika penambahan tanggal melewati bulan berikutnya? Tentu saja bakalan menjadi masalah bukan?

Di Visual Basic kasus ini dengan sangat mudah ditangani dengan menggunakan fungsi bawaan yang bernama DateAdd() dengan hasil yang sangat stabil, dan sebenarnya PHP pun telah menyediakan fungsi yang serupa, date_add() namun setelah dicoba terdapat banyak kesalahan dan cukup membuat frustasi. Akhirnya bikin script custom saja, dan hasilnya terbilang cukup memuaskan, paling tidak menurut saya sendiri, berikut scriptnya